I N D I A N E V E N T, C U LT U R A L M E A N I N G O F F O O D I N I N D I A N E V E N T S Food in India means celebration, hospitality and tradition. It could be the wedding feast at Bengali with ?sh curry and mishti doi, Punjabi, one with butter chicken and kulcha or the South Indian one with dosa and sambar, but the food says something. Guests do not only come to events; they savor them with their taste buds. The famous saying in India is ,Atithi Devo Bhava (guests are gods) but it is not just a language; it is a duty. You cannot just disappoint taste buds when you serve them inferior things, nor can you bring shame to this sacred tradition of hospitality; it’s part and parcel of the Indian culture. M E E T S V A R I E T Y O F D I E T S
The astonishing diversity of India is that even any meeting/gathering may contain vegetarians, vegans, as well as Jains, who have their own limitations in regard to what they can/cannot eat, and guests may be intolerant towards some of the foods. The correct catering company in india will sail through all these requirements with ease and, in many cases, will o?er innovative alternatives that will make everyone feel included. They learn about the necessity of di?erent cooking zones for vegetarian and non-vegetarian foods, labeling and cultural issues of food preparation and serving. K E Y FA C TO R S F O R C H O O S I N G T H E R I G H T C AT E R I N G C O M PA N Y I N I N D I A E X P E R T I S E I N R E G I O N A L C U I S I N E S India’s culinary landscape is incredibly diverse. Look for caterers who specialize in the type of cuisine you want to serve. A company expert in North Indian food might struggle with authentic South Indian dishes, and vice versa. F O O D S A F E T Y A N D H Y G I E N E S TA N D A R D S Verify that your chosen caterer follows proper food safety protocols. Check for FSSAI (Food Safety and Standards Authority of India) certi?cation, proper storage facilities, and hygiene practices. Don’t hesitate to visit their k h k b h f d h dl d

T R A I N I N G O F S E R V I C E S E C O I R S Highly trained service personnel are aware of the Indian hospitality culture and will be able to describe dishes to guests and serve food according to cultural and religious beliefs. They ought to be knowledgeable of ingredients in order to assist the guests that have dietary restrictions. R E F E R E N C E S / R E V I E W S Personal recommendations have a lot of value in India, where things work on a relationship basis. Ask for recommendations based on events that happened recently, read reviews online and where possible, drop in to an event they are attending and see how they serve you.
